Jade Jamacia Landry Obituary

Jade Jamacia Landry was born in Plaquemine, Louisiana at River West Hospital on January 3, 1995, to parents, Stephanie Landry and Cyril Simon. Jade was an outgoing, loveable, and respectful young lady. She was also very fancy and prissy. Jade would always greet with a smile, a hug, and a kiss. A true sweetheart. Everybody loved Jade. Her aura was always bright and glowing. The dimples on her face could warm any heart. She lived her life to the fullest and did exactly what she set her mind to. At the tender age of twelve, Jade accepted Jesus Christ as her Lord and savior. She was baptized at Greater Israel Baptist Church by Reverend Reginald Dawson. Jade put GOD first in everything she did. She attended Donaldsonville Elementary, Lowery Middle, and became a cheerleader at Donaldsonville High School, made many friends, graduating class of 2013. Jade was called to her heavenly home on November 3, 2021, in Baton Rouge at Our Lady of the Lake hospital. She leaves to cherish her memories her fiancé, Dontrell Schonberg. From their loving 11-year union, two beautiful children were born: Miracle and Dontrell “D2” Schonberg, Jr. She leaves her mother: Stephanie Landry, Dad: Kerry “Huff” Anderson, biological father: Cyril Simon, 3 sisters: Vanity Landry, Mecalette (William) McDowell, and DaQuita (Byron) Johnson, 2 brothers: Johnathan Spriggs, and Rechard (Tasheba) Lewis, Mother In Law: Melissa Schonberg, Sister In Law: Keondra Schonberg, God Sister: Taylor Landry, God Brother: Melvin “Tank” Landry, God Child: Kailey Broussard, 1 Niece: Nala McDowell, 1 Nephew: William McDowell Jr., Maternal Grandfather: Joseph Landry Jr., Paternal Grandmother: Cleo Simon, aunts: Rosalyn (Lawrence) Johnson and Ursula Landry, uncles: Joseph (Jessica) Landry III, Troy (Keela) Landry, and a host of aunts, uncles, cousins, and friends. Jade was preceded in death by her maternal Grandmother: Jo Ann Bell-Landry, uncle: Furnell Landry, maternal Great-Grandmother: Adeline Fleming-Landry, Niece: Niagha McDowell, paternal Grandfather: Wilfred D. Simon.
